Transaction 6014e49e03258c709d6f91c8fc222061b95247a6700d56a99dc127a71b5ca735
1 Input
2 Outputs
- 6014e49e03258c709d6f91c8fc222061b95247a6700d56a99dc127a71b5ca735:0
- 6014e49e03258c709d6f91c8fc222061b95247a6700d56a99dc127a71b5ca735:1
value 267246
address 3MGoaSmNFKzYZPqSLXoNaMzPyJK9CnLLXa
value 6766158
address 12d95ZyuJP8ZkyYASfNrFAFmxh3nTVj9iZ